Prayers

I have lots to post about and a hundred pictures, but for now, I want to just give a quick update and ask for your prayers. Wednesday was my 35 week appointment. I was diagnosed with mild preeclampsia- high blood pressure, some swelling in my feet, and an elevated level of protein in my urine. It hit within a day or two, with no warning signs. I actually feel great! I still have lots of energy and my sense of humor.

My doctor was quite concerned and wanted me to stop working, but I begged for another week, just to see how it goes. I am on bedrest/light duty until I go back to work on Monday. My doctor is going to let me work Monday, Tuesday, and Wednesday and then go back for my next appointment on Wednesday. We are both praying that I have either eliminated a symptom of the preeclampsia, or that it has at least not gotten worse.

Yesterday, I was 35 weeks, but measuring four weeks ahead!! Yikes! My Dr. said I am as big as a woman in her 39th week. He keeps saying that this baby will be a big boy if I can make it full term. But, right now that little Harbor still needs his lungs to develop. I am praying God will let him bake at least two to three more weeks.
